STEPS/PROCEDURES FOR NIPR STUDENT REGISTRATION:

- Students obtain registration form either by downloading from the Institute’s website or it can be picked up from any of our offices in Abuja or Lagos.

- Payment of Ten thousand naira (#10,000) being the registration fees which is to be paid into the Institute’s account.

- Submission of forms to the office. The form must be filled with all necessary documents attached (SSCE Result and other relevant documents) including four passport photographs.

STEPS FOR EXAM REGISTRATION:

* The registration form is screened by the Exam officer to determine what level of exam student is to sit for.

* Upon confirmation, the student gets to pay the exam fee.

* The student tenders the payment teller and is given an examination form to fill and submit.

* The student gets a copy of the syllabus upon completion of Registration.

Once all forms have been submitted and documents verified, the student will be communicated by email/SMS on the notification for exams and also a copy of the exam time table would be sent. The student would also receive his/her exams ID card with an Exam /Registration number.

The Registration number is valid for 3 years from the date of Registration which is renewable upon expiration with the sum of #5, 000, payable to the Institute’s account.

EXAM FEE BREAKDOWN:

Certificate Level:

Each Certificate course costs N3, 000 x 10 subjects: N30, 000

Administration fee: N4, 000

Registration Fee: N10, 000

Total: N44, 000


Diploma Level:

Each course costs N4, 000 (N4, 000 x 5 courses): N20, 000

Registration fee: N10, 000

Administration fee of N4, 000

Total: N34, 000


EXEMPTION:

Graduates of Mass communication who wish to sit for the diploma exams will be granted exemption from the Certificate stage upon the submission of their transcript and a payment of #30, 000 being the exemption fee.

RESULTS:

Once results are released, it will be uploaded on the website and notifications (through mails and SMS) will be sent to students so that they can check their results on the website using their registration numbers. The hardcopies will be pasted on our Notice boards at the Abuja and Lagos offices.

STATEMENT OF RESULTS:

Students can pick up their statements of result immediately the results are released.

TRANSCRIPT:

To be sent based on request by intending Institution/party. The student bears the cost of courier, depending on the state/ Country it is to be sent to.

NYSC EXEMTION.

The NYSC exemption is a certificate issued by NYSC. It is issued to our students who have completed the Institute’s Certificate and Diploma exams. For now, the exemption certificate from NYSC is on hold as the Institute is renewing its terms with the NYSC.
